Luke Davies was born in Sydney in 1962. He has worked variously as a teacher, journalist and script editor. Luke Davies' collection of poetry Absolute Event Horizon was shortlisted for the 1995 Turnbull Fox Phillips poetry prize
Luke Davies (born 1962, Sydney) is an Australian writer of novels and poetry.
Davies grew up in West Pymble, Sydney, in a middle-class Catholic family. He went to a private school and then to the University of Sydney to study for an arts degree. He published his first poetry collection, Four Plots for Magnets, in 1982, in his third year. "
His novel Candy, recently made into a film starring the late Heath Ledger. His other works include another novel, Isabelle the Navigator, and poetry Four Plots for Magnets, Absolute Event Horizon, Running With Light and Totem.
